New Product Introduction (NPI) Engineer
Description

The New Product Introduction (NPI) Engineer is responsible for leading the implementation of new products from development into full-scale manufacturing. This role ensures that product manufacturing processes, equipment, designs, and documentation are fully validated and ready for operational handoff. The NPI Engineer collaborates cross-functionally with Engineering, Quality, Supply Chain, and Operations to establish robust, repeatable production processes and ensure a smooth transition into ongoing manufacturing. All design work must be executed in accordance with current Quality Management System (QMS) requirements.


Key Job Responsibilities:

Customer Product Implementation (aka Product Realization) / New Product Implementation

• Lead the introduction of new customer products into manufacturing.

• Review customer designs, specifications, and documentation to ensure manufacturability and compliance with internal capabilities.

• Lead the introduction of new products from development into manufacturing.

• Develop and execute operational implementation plans for product launch and manufacturing readiness of customer projects.

• Coordinate cross-functional activities required for product introduction, including engineering, quality, supply chain, and operations.

Process Development & Setup

• Define and document manufacturing processes, workflows, and work instructions.

• Support design for manufacturability (DFM) and design for assembly (DFA) reviews.

• Identify tooling, equipment, fixtures, and infrastructure required for production.

• Collaborate with engineering and operations teams to optimize assembly processes and material flow.


Validation & Qualification

• Develop and execute validation protocols such as:

o Process validation (OQ/PQ where applicable)

o Equipment qualification (IQ/OQ/ where applicable)

o Test method validation

o Installation and setup verification (FAT/SAT)

• Support activities related to:

o First Article Inspection (FAI)

o Process capability studies

o Risk assessments (PFMEA)

Product & Process Documentation

• Generate and maintain required documentation including:

o Test reports

o Process flow diagrams

o Work instructions

o Validation reports

o Ensure documentation is complete and ready for operational use.

Pilot Builds & Production Ramp

• Plan and execute pilot builds and initial production runs.

• Troubleshoot product and process issues during scale up and early manufacturing.

• Implement improvements to optimize quality, efficiency, and yield.

Transfer to Operations

• Ensure manufacturing processes are stable, documented, and ready for production teams.

• Conduct formal handoff of products and processes to Operations.

• Train operations personnel on new processes and product requirements.

• Provide training and technical support to production teams during ramp-up.

• Ensure successful transfer of validated processes to production teams.

Continuous Improvement

• Capture lessons learned during projects.

• Support ongoing improvements in manufacturing readiness and product launch processes.
